I had a section of lawn that had crabgrass in years past.
This spring I used a product that contains Dimension (thanks ahlg).
It worked great. I have some stray crabgrass plants
that I deal with spot treatment.


Will I ruin my Dimension for next year if I de-thatch
this fall/next spring? That is, how long do I have to
wait for the crabgrass seeds to finally die before I'm
able to dethatch?

----------------------------------------------------


I'm just curious. Why would de-thatching interfere with the pre-emergent?


The pre-emergent creates an invisible "barrier" that the weeds can't poke
through. Any distruption of that barrier renders it useless.
